Joy Mathur to play Krishna's cousin Shishupal in Star Plus' Mahabharat

Actor Joy Mathur will be the next entry in Siddharth Kumar Tewary’s magnum opus Mahabharat on Star Plus.
Joy has been roped in to play the role of Shishupal, who is supposed to be a distant cousin of Krishna (Saurabh Raj Jain).
In Mahabharat, Krishna would have carried away Rukmini, the intended wife of Shishupal. There is also a story of Krishna giving a vow to Shishupal’s mother, that he would pardon his cousin Shishupal hundred times before he decides to kill him. However, Krishna would be destined to kill Shishupal when he would commit his hundred and first mistake at Yudhishtir’s Rajasuya Yagna by dishonouring Krishna. This would be when Krishna will kill Shishupal.
